    Debenhams

    Debenhams is one of the most historic department store chains in the United Kingdom, founded in 1778 as a high-end drapers' store located in London's Wigmore Street. The company has grown to become a major player in the British retail industry, with more than 200 stores across the world and exclusive partnerships with the top designers Jasper Conran and Julien Macdonald.

    Burton Group took over the retailer in 1985. This group later merged with Arcadia, a retail empire headed by Sir Philip Green. Within a couple of years, profits declined and debts ballooned since the retailer was entangled into lease agreements that were costly and long-term.

    In 2021 the brand was bought by the online rival Boohoo and its physical stores shut down. In the last two years, only four out of ten former Debenhams stores in GB have been renovated. The remaining stores remain empty. Some of the stores that were once there have been converted into mixed-use developments, while others have been repurposed for different brands such as Next Beauty Hall and The Range. Wales has the highest percentage of vacant ex Debenhams locations. Northern Ireland and the Midlands are next.

    House of Fraser

    House of Fraser is a department store chain founded in Glasgow, online Shopping uk Scotland in 1849. It began as a drapery shop, and later added a variety of products including luggage and shoes. Later, the company began to expand, acquiring rival stores like Bentalls. The company also expanded its own line of clothing fashions, introducing the Linea brand.

    Despite its rapid growth, House of Fraser struggled to keep up with changing shopping patterns of UK customers. Their financial woes were exacerbated by the growth of online retailers, as well as the decline of traditional high-street stores. In addition, the company had too many inventory items and a heavy debt burden.

    In 2003, Tom Hunter made a hostile offer to purchase the company with the hope of merging it with Allders, a different department store in which there were shares. During this time, many House of Fraser shops in Scotland were shut down or sold. Mike Ashley bought the company and was planning to rename Frasers and open new stores. This acquisition has caused some supplier relationships to be damaged, which has led to uncertainty within the company.
